Lineage II anniversary event runs into snag, now extended to May 12

Massively:

"5 years of operation for a massively multiplayer online game is cause for celebration. The sad fact is that many games never live that long, and not all titles that run for 5 years have a lot of steam left by that point. This doesn't seem to be the case with Lineage II which still appears to be going strong in both Korea and in the West. Massively recently interviewed the Lineage II developers about the 5-year milestone they've just hit with the game, and we also mentioned the anniversary celebration was about to get underway."
